Rotisserie "Chicken Parmesan" with Spaghetti Squash & Basil

  • 40 min
  • 2–6 servings
  • 618 kcal / serving

This dish pairs tender rotisserie chicken with a bright marinara and melty parmesan, served over noodle-like spaghetti squash. It makes a cozy weeknight meal that’s lower in carbs but still satisfying.

Ingredients

  • ½ small pkgfresh basil
  • ½ (24 oz) jarmarinara sauce
  • ½ cupParmesan cheese, shredded
  • ½ (30 oz) whole chickenrotisserie chicken, white and dark meat
  • 1 mediumspaghetti squash

From the pantry: black pepper, extra virgin olive oil, garlic powder, salt

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 500°F and position the rack in the center. Line a baking sheet with foil if you like easier cleanup.
  2. Rinse and dry the spaghetti squash, trim ends, cut it in half lengthwise, and scoop out the seeds. Brush the cut sides with oil and sprinkle with salt and pepper.
  3. Place the squash halves cut-side down on the prepared sheet and slide into the oven. Roast until a knife easily pierces the flesh, about 20–25 minutes.
  4. Meanwhile, remove the meat from the rotisserie chicken and shred it into bite-size pieces on a cutting board. Place the chicken in a small baking dish.
  5. Wash and dry the basil, then tear and thinly slice enough leaves to add to the chicken. Reserve the rest for serving.
  6. Pour the marinara over the chicken, season with garlic powder, and stir to combine.
  7. Put the dish in the oven and heat until the sauce and chicken are warm, about 10 minutes. Sprinkle the cheese over the top and bake until melted, about 5 minutes more.
  8. When the squash is ready, shred the flesh with a fork to create strands. Serve the squash alongside the chicken, finishing with the remaining basil.

Two tips

  • Prep the squash ahead of time and store the roasted flesh in the fridge for quick bowls later in the week.
  • Swap in another grated hard cheese you have on hand, or add an extra pinch of pepper for a different finish, keeping to the listed ingredients.
